Output cf3489e92ddf264057b734d388083f9bae486439aadde30978634cfa863da063:44

value
245299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9fa5fd36268ef273b046a15294dbc3dab920dc7 OP_EQUAL
address
3HBn4Gwx5krauET88C2wKGiB4i2iAdyZS7
transaction
cf3489e92ddf264057b734d388083f9bae486439aadde30978634cfa863da063
confirmations
268503
spent
true